Explanation:

"Calculator" is a four-syllable noun, and in English, many nouns have primary stress on the first syllable.

Pronounced: CAL-cu-la-tor

IPA: /ˈkæl.kjʊ.leɪ.tər/

✅ Final Answer: A. CAL-cu-la-tor
